With corporate headquarters located in Brooklyn’s Sheepshead Bay neighborhood for decades, Mini-Circuits is proud to support the homegrown BayFest celebration right in our backyard.
As a sponsor of the 30th annual BayFest on May 21, 2023, we saw firsthand just how enlivening the long-running block party is for residents and businesses in this tucked away corner of Brooklyn. Bands rocked the three stages along 27th Street all through the afternoon while festivalgoers strolled the waterfront on Emmons Avenue for a half mile of raffles, giveaways, food, and fun under perfect pre-summer weather. The event was free and family friendly.

Between its maritime history, cultural diversity, and coastal scenery, Sheepshead Bay is one of New York City’s best kept secrets. It was once seen as Brooklyn’s own French Riviera for classic seaside getaways and has since become a tight-knight community that enjoys the ideal balance of quaintness and liveliness.
